Destery
DES-ter-ee
Destery is a boy’s name of English origin, meaning “Likely a modern invented name, sounding similar to Destiny.”, and peaked in popularity in 2014.
What Destery Means
“Likely a modern invented name, sounding similar to Destiny.”

Jack is a diminutive of John, meaning 'God is gracious'. It is of English origin.

Derived from an English surname, meaning "son of Hudd". Hudd is a medieval diminutive of Hugh, derived from the Germanic element "hugu" meaning "heart, mind, spirit".
